Usage:
Fillers of plastic such as for plastic, rubber, paper, polyvinyl chloride (PVC),
polyethylene (PE), polypropylene (PP), ABS, etc.
Characteristic:
1) Identical grain size, low oil absorption value
2) To reduce the cost of products; to make products have good foamed effect
3) To enhance hardness, rigidity, size stability, fire-retardantness, glossiness
of products
4) Calcium carbonate is used for high polymer material to improve the craftwork
of processing and enhance the mechanics and hot stability of products; It
can reduce the cost with the enhancement of dispersibility and compatibility
Specifications:
1) Light calcium carbonate
2) Main Constituent (CaCO3): ≥96%
3) PH (10% solid quit): 8.0 - 10.0%, 105<sup>o</sup>C
4) Volatile: ≤0.50%
5) Insoluble substance in hydrochloric acid: ≤ 0.3%
6) Settling value: ≥2.2ml/g
7) Average grain: 1.5 - 3.5μm
8) Fe: ≤0.10%
9) Mn: ≤0.010%
10) Screenings 125μm: ≤0.010%, 45μ: ≤0.40%
11) Whiteness (R457): ≥94
12) Appearance: powder
